udpating OS X server

This is similar to another current thread but I didn't want to clutter it with my own question. I'm currently running OS X Server at 10.0.4. Can I safely install the 10.1 client update on top of of X server without losing any serving features/functions? Right now it's horribly slow and could really benefit from the optimization.

I was able to upgrade without a hitch, but I didn't have a huge load on the server yet. For what it's worth, the only people I've seen complaining about the upgrade had made some pretty heavy tweaks to Apache and lost all their work to the upgrade. You should definitely back up your config files and whatnot.
